After listening to Ronnie talk about time off i think i'll crank up my training the first week of Dec instead of this week. Ronnie, although he has 25+ yrs of training under his belt, discussed the importance of time off from training and how his muscles aren't going anywhere if he takes some time off. He used an analogy of a car, he said if he doesn't drive his car for 3 months it doesn't mean that when he goes to drive it that it won't work after not driving it for 3 months.
Although i don't have 25+ yrs of training behind me, i think i should be able to take about 3 wks off to heal up and my muscles not go anywhere.
I miss training tho... Time off is harder than i thought

OFFICIAL OFF SEASON DIET STARTS TODAY!!
Meal 1 (8am)
3 scoops protein (made with 10oz 2% milk)
1 medium banana
2 tbsp peanut butter
Meal 2 (10am)
2 cups oatmeal
10 egg whites
Meal 3 (12pm)
8oz steak or lean ground beef
10oz sweet potato
½ cup almonds
Meal 4 (2pm)
2 cups rice
12oz white meat
2 oranges
Meal 5 (5pm)
2 cups oatmeal
10oz white meat
1oz dark chocolate
Meal 6 (8pm)
3 scoops protein
2 scoops waximazie
Post Cardio
20oz Gatorade or Powerade
Meal 7 (10pm)
10oz white meat
2 cups white rice
1 avocado
Meal 8 (12am)
3 scoops protein
Carbs = 678g
Protein = 512g
Fats = 102
Total Calories = 5678
